Bookkeepers must compile comprehensive financial records to ensure that all income, deductions, and credits are accurately reported. Errors in tax filings can lead to audits or penalties, making precision paramount. Many bookkeepers utilize tax software like TurboTax or H&R Block to streamline this process, ensuring that calculations are accurate and deadlines are met. These tools often include features that help identify potential deductions or tax credits, providing financial benefits to the organization. Full charge bookkeeper duties include preparing the balance sheet and income statement at the end of the month. They are run after the books are closed and are submitted to a CPA to verify accuracy and then to the owners or management to apprise them of the financial health of the company. In today’s digital age, bookkeeping tasks are largely automated, and being well-versed in accounting software is essential. Proficiency in software such as QuickBooks or Xero allows bookkeepers to efficiently manage financial transactions, track expenses, and generate accurate financial reports. With the ability to navigate through various accounting software features, bookkeepers can streamline their work process and ensure the accuracy of financial data.

Maintaining a healthy cash flow is crucial for any business, and as a full charge bookkeeper, you play a key role in monitoring and managing cash flow. This involves tracking all cash inflows and outflows, ensuring sufficient funds are available to meet the company’s financial obligations, and identifying potential cash flow issues. By effectively monitoring cash flow, you help the company maintain financial stability and make strategic decisions to optimize cash utilization. Full Charge Bookkeepers are also responsible for preparing financial statements, such as balance sheets, income statements, and cash flow statements. These statements provide a clear snapshot of the organization’s financial health and performance.
